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. (KRQE) –Christina Bennett took a plea deal in two different cases, pleading no contest to child abandonment resulting in death, child abuse, aggravated fleeing from police.

Court records show in 2023 Bennet showed up at her parents house in Albuquerque, saying her 4-month-old daughter was dead. An autopsy says the cause of death is undetermined, but they did find meth in the babies system. Witnesses told police Bennett was a drug user and would breastfeed the baby. Days earlier, Bennett led police on a chase with the baby after shoplifting at a gas station.
Bennett is facing between four and 12 years at sentencing. A sentencing date has not yet been set.
